DSM were appointed by our client New Substance as Principal Contractor, to demolish and clear a retired North Sea off-shore gas rig at Weston Super Mare on the Somerset Coast. The rig had been transported on shore and transformed into a 35m high 500 tonne art installation and visitor experience by New Substance as part of a nationwide arts festival “Unboxed”.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

When the former rig was stripped back to its original configuration following the festival, DSM used our specifically modified CAT 6015B demolition rig ( known as “The Beast”) to systematically reduce and clear the rig. The 250 tonne demolition rig equipped with a 10 Tonne Fortress shear attachment safely dismantled the ex-rig following designed pre-weakening of the structure, carried out manually using flame cutting equipment. The dismantling operations were carried out on a confined site surrounded by numerous live gas and electricity services.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

DSM successfully completed the rig superstructure demolition in 3 weeks period!!
